In reading, we will being a new unit on context clues. This is a very important skill for 3rd graders as we move into deeper comprehension of what we're reading. When reading with your child at home, don't just tell them what an unknown word means, ask them to look for clues around the word to help them figure out the definition.

Later in the week, we will begin a unit on plural nouns. We will learn about the different rules for plural nouns starting with regular plurals which just need an -s and plurals that need -es. As we learn these rules, your child should start to apply them in his or her writing.
